About Local Financial
Company Overview
Local Financial is a forex and CFD broker registered in the United Kingdom in April 2021. The company operates under the legal name Local Financial and maintains an online presence at localfinancial.ltd. As of this review, the broker does not hold any recognised regulatory licenses from financial authorities in the UK or elsewhere, which is a significant consideration for traders evaluating counterparty risk.
Despite being registered as a UK company, Local Financial is not authorised by the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) or any other major regulator. This lack of oversight means that client funds are not protected by compensation schemes such as the Financial Services Compensation Scheme (FSCS) or subject to standard segregation requirements.
Account Tiers and Platforms
Local Financial offers four account types, all based on the MetaTrader 5 (MT5) platform. The accounts include MT5.DirectFX and MT5.Classic, alongside two cent-denominated variants (cent-MT5.Classic and cent-MT5.DirectFX) designed for traders with smaller capital. All accounts carry a maximum leverage of 1:400, which is considered high risk, especially for retail traders.
The broker does not specify minimum deposit requirements for any account type, suggesting that clients can fund accounts with any amount. The use of MT5 provides access to advanced charting, automated trading via Expert Advisors, and a range of analytical tools.
Trading Instruments
According to the broker's marketing materials, Local Financial covers a wide array of asset classes including forex pairs, stock CFDs, indices, cryptocurrencies, precious metals, and commodities. This multi-asset offering is typical of modern retail brokers aiming to attract diversified traders. However, no specific number of instruments or contract specifications are publicly listed.
The broker advertises a minimum spread of 0.1 points, likely referring to raw spreads on ECN accounts. Spreads on classic accounts may be wider, but official data is not disclosed. The combination of high leverage, low spreads, and zero minimum deposit is aggressive and warrants extra caution.
Risk Considerations
Local Financial is rated with a severe risk score by FXCanary due to its unregulated status and high leverage offerings. The absence of regulatory oversight means that there is no independent authority to handle disputes or ensure fair trading practices. Additionally, aggregated industry data and user feedback have flagged difficulties in withdrawing funds, which is a common red flag for problematic brokers.
Traders considering Local Financial should be aware that they are assuming substantial counterparty risk. Without a regulated safety net, the broker's internal policies on fund segregation, order execution, and dispute resolution cannot be verified.
Customer Support and Transparency
Public information about Local Financial's customer support channels is limited. The website likely offers contact forms, email, or live chat, but details are not prominently featured in available records. The company's UK registration does not guarantee responsive customer service.
The broker's transparency is further reduced by the lack of audited financial statements or disclosure of company directors. For risk-averse traders, this opacity is a significant deterrent.
